Soft Landing on the Horizon? (E193)

from DoubleLine Minutes · host DoubleLine

After reviewing stocks (0:48), bond (2:43) and commodities (4:26), plus bitcoin (5:17) topping $100,000, DoubleLine Portfolio Managers Jeff Mayberry and Samuel Lau unpack the past two weeks’ macro news (6:10). ISM manufacturing, payroll and jobs data suggestive, Jeff says, suggest that “maybe the Fed is going to be able to do the soft landing.” Turning to federal funds rate probabilities (12:27), future contracts are pricing in 3½ cuts through the end of 2025, inferring Sam notes more restrained policy than suggested to date in Fed guidance. Looking ahead to the Dec. 9-13 market week, topping their watch list will be the November CPI report, due Wednesday – the last CPI print before the Federal Open Market Committee meeting on Dec. 18.
